Can I add WPA3 to my router?
Even when you get a WPA3-enabled router, you’ll need WPA3-compatible client devices—your laptop, phone, and anything else that connects to Wi-Fi—to fully take advantage of these new features. The good news is that the same router can accept both WPA2 and WPA3 connections at the same time.
How do I configure my router to use WPA2 or WPA3 Virgin Media?

- Enter 192.168.0.1 into your browser.
- Enter your admin name and password*
- Once signed in, go to Advanced settings > Wireless. > Security.
- Select the dropdown next to Security and change it to WPA2-PSK **
- Select Apply changes.

How do I check my router security settings?
Every router has a different menu layout, but you should be able to find encryption under the “Wireless” or “Security” menu. You’ll have a number of encryption options; if you still have an older router, you want to select one that starts with “WPA2”.

How do I access my virgin router settings?
In normal router mode you access the Virgin Media router settings by: Typing http://192.168.0.1 into your web browser (or by clicking on the link to the left) Entering the router settings password in the box shown on screen – you’ll find that password on a sticker on the base of the router.
Where is the encryption key on my router?
The default encryption key may be located on the bottom of your router or in the manual, depending on the router manufacturer. You can locate the encryption key when you log into the router setup page, if you have created your own encryption key.

What is WPA2 AES or WPA3?
Released in 2018, WPA3 is the next generation of WPA and has better security features. It protects against weak passwords that can be cracked relatively easily via guessing. Unlike WEP and WPA, WPA2 uses the AES standard instead of the RC4 stream cipher.
What is the difference between WPA2 and WPA3?
WPA3 provides a more secure connection than WPA2, but many WiFi devices might not yet detect WPA3 and support only WPA2. Similarly, WPA2 provides a more secure connection than WPA, but some legacy WiFi devices do not detect WPA2 and support only WPA.
